ت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
كيف يتم ربط الجدولين
#1
سلام عليكم 
كيف يتم ربط جدولين معا علما ان جدول اول يحتوي علي حقول (رقم الموظف واسم الموظف) وجدول التاني يحتوي علي حقول(رقم الموظف والراتب جهة العمل) اريد ربط الحقل رقم الموظف في جدول الاول مع رقم الموظف في جدول التاني
sql server 2008 R2
الرد }}}
تم الشكر بواسطة:
#2
وعليكم السلام  

الفكره هي باستخدام  :  INNER JOIN 

اقرا جملة الاستعلام لتفهم طريقة الاستخدام  :


كود :
SELECT Emp.Name, Salary.ID
FROM EmployeeTable
INNER JOIN SalaryTable
ON EmployeeTable.ID=SalaryTable.EmpID;


حيث EmployeeTable  :  جدول الموظفين مثلا
و SalaryTable  :  جدول الرواتب 
SalaryTable.EmpID : رقم الموظف كمفتاح اجنبي بجدول الرواتب 
EmployeeTable.ID: رقم الموظف كمفتاح  Primary key  


يمكنك قراءة المزيد بخصوص هذا الموضوع  من هذا الرابط  :  

http://www.w3schools.com/sql/sql_join_inner.asp

لان فيه علاقات اخرى مثل  Outer Join   ،  Right Join  ،  Left Join   ،  اقرأ عنها لاني متأكد سيأتي يوم  ستحتاجها  .

بالتوفيق
اسم معرفي : محمد يحيى
الرد }}}
تم الشكر بواسطة: ممدوح
#3
بارك الله فيك
الرد }}}
تم الشكر بواسطة:
#4
أحسن الله إليكم وجعله  في ميزان حسناتكم
إذا طُعِنتَ من الخلفِ فاعلمْ أنك في المقدمةِ
الرد }}}
تم الشكر بواسطة:


الت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م